相关文章

basic在c语言中是常量吗,QBASIC中的常量

Basic语言是计算机高级语言的一种,它简单、易学、好用,被广大计算机用户所青睐。Basic语言的表达式与数学中的表达式相似,语句与自然语言相仿,极容易被初学者掌握,而Basic语言的最新发展Visual Basic 6.0、7.0&#xf…

Direct I/O in DOSBOX for COMM serial communications with QBasic, TBasic or Pbasic

DOSBOX虚拟环境能在WIN10和LINUX平台上支持DOS、WIN3x、Win9x程序运行。串口是当年计算机硬件的标配,经RS232-RS485转换后轻松实现远距离数据通讯,这些当年的程序和设备在今天的DOSBOX下也还是可以使用的。DOS、QuickBasic、TurboBasic、PowerBasic&…

逆向QBasic7.1笔记

一、前言 最近接触了一个QBasic编写的16位程序的逆向,该程序是运行在纯DOS环境下,虽然此环境已离我们远去,能接触到的机会不是太多,但为了防止有意外碰到的同学像我最开始那样走弯路,特此将该笔记整理一下发出,希望对需要的同学有些帮助.由于时间仓促,研究不深文中难免有错误之…

前端使用 Konva 实现可视化设计器(12)- 连接线 - 直线

这一章实现的连接线,目前仅支持直线连接,为了能够不影响原有的其它功能,尝试了2、3个实现思路,最终实测这个实现方式目前来说最为合适了。 请大家动动小手,给我一个免费的 Star 吧~ 大家如果发现了 Bug,欢迎…

React Konva 安装和配置指南

React Konva 安装和配置指南 react-konva React Canvas Love. JavaScript library for drawing complex canvas graphics using React. 项目地址: https://gitcode.com/gh_mirrors/re/react-konva 1. 项目基础介绍和主要编程语言 项目基础介绍 React Konva 是一个用…

React-Konva 开源项目教程

React-Konva 开源项目教程 项目地址:https://gitcode.com/gh_mirrors/re/react-konva 1. 目录结构及介绍 React-Konva 是一个将 React 和 HTML5 Canvas 结合使用的 JavaScript 库,它使在 Canvas 上绘制复杂的图形变得简单且声明式。下面是其基础的目录结构概览&a…

前端使用 Konva 实现可视化设计器(22)- 绘制图形(矩形、直线、折线)

本章分享一下如何使用 Konva 绘制基础图形:矩形、直线、折线,希望大家继续关注和支持哈! 请大家动动小手,给我一个免费的 Star 吧~ 大家如果发现了 Bug,欢迎来提 Issue 哟~ github源码 gitee源码 示例地址 矩形 先上效…

canvas实战系列一(Konva实现基本流程图)

一、建设背景 由于一个项目上需要实现在系统中展现整体流程图,并可以根据不同颜色显示不同节点的完成状态,且节点可以点击进去查看节点详情。具体流程图如下: 二、实现思路 一开始是想通过原始canvas,封装画圆圈,画矩形…

Konva基本处理流程和相关架构设计

前言 canvas是使用JavaScript基于上下文对象进行2D图形的绘制的HTML元素,通常用于动画、游戏画面、数据可视化、图片编辑以及实时视频处理等方面。基于Canvas之上,诞生了例如 PIXI、ZRender、Fabric、Konva等 Canvas渲染引擎,兼顾易用的同时…

react中使用react-konva实现画板框选内容

文章目录 一、前言1.1、`API`文档1.2、`Github`仓库二、图形2.1、拖拽`draggable`2.2、图片`Image`2.3、变形`Transformer`三、实现3.1、依赖3.2、源码3.2.1、`KonvaContainer`组件3.2.2、`use-key-press`文件3.3、效果图四、最后一、前言 本文用到的react-konva是基于react封…

canvas库 konva 实现腾讯文档 [日历视图]

效果图实现展示 为什么实现这个功能? canvas大部分用于画图设计之类的功能,大厂用 canvas 用于业务实现,新颖性。大厂的这些用于商用的功能实现都不开源,自我实现具有挑战性。 功能分析 主体展示 : 日历表的绘制功能…

基于 Konva 实现Web PPT 编辑器(二)

动画系统 为了实现演示中复杂的动画效果,使用 Animation 类统一管理;切换动画通过 css animation 实现,并且是应用在 konvajs-content 上,动画则通过 gsap 实现,应用在 Konva.Node 上,实现思路如下&#xf…

React Konva 使用教程

React Konva 使用教程 项目地址:https://gitcode.com/gh_mirrors/re/react-konva 项目介绍 React Konva 是一个用于在 React 中绘制复杂 canvas 图形的 JavaScript 库。它提供了声明式和响应式的绑定,使得在 React 应用中使用 Konva 框架变得更加容易。React Kon…

Konva框选移动

效果&#xff0c;可以单独点击控制大小&#xff0c;也可框选控制 代码&#xff1a; <template><div class"rect"><div id"canvas"></div> <!-- 画布容器 --></div> </template><script setup lang"ts&…

Vue Konva 项目教程

Vue Konva 项目教程 项目地址:https://gitcode.com/gh_mirrors/vu/vue-konva 1、项目的目录结构及介绍 Vue Konva 项目的目录结构如下&#xff1a; vue-konva/ ├── src/ │ ├── components/ │ │ ├── VLayer.vue │ │ ├── VStage.vue │ │ └…

Konva 项目教程

Konva 项目教程 项目地址:https://gitcode.com/gh_mirrors/kon/konva 目录结构及介绍 Konva 项目的目录结构如下&#xff1a; konva/ ├── src/ │ ├── shapes/ │ ├── filters/ │ ├── plugins/ │ ├── core.js │ ├── stage.js │ ├── l…

Konva 实现指示框

Konva 实现指示框 还是先上效果图 封装 封装成了hooks&#xff0c;可以在vue或者react中使用&#xff0c;也是一份学习资料 代码 从左到右的渐变背景和边框 我采用的是线性渐变&#xff0c;通过createLinearGradient传递两个像素点分别为开始像素点和结束像素点&#xff0c…

Konva中滚动问题

现在有两个group,想要的效果时拖动绿的group时&#xff0c;红色group按照相同方向移动同样距离 可以在绿的group的拖动方法中 通过move方法 移动红色的group

基于 Konva 实现Web PPT 编辑器(一)

前言 目前Web PPT编辑比较好的库有PPTist(PPTist体验地址)&#xff0c;是基于DOM 的渲染方案&#xff0c;相比 Canvas 渲染的方案&#xff0c;在复杂场景下性能会存在一定的差距。不过确实已经很不错了&#xff0c;本应用在一些实现思路、难点攻克上也参考了pptist的思想&#…

前端使用 Konva 实现可视化设计器(23)- 绘制曲线、属性面板

本章分享一下如何使用 Konva 绘制基础图形&#xff1a;曲线&#xff0c;以及属性面板的基本实现思路&#xff0c;希望大家继续关注和支持哈&#xff08;多求 5 个 Stars 谢谢&#xff09;&#xff01; 请大家动动小手&#xff0c;给我一个免费的 Star 吧~ 大家如果发现了 Bug&a…